Pro Tips for‌ Troubleshooting and Maintaining​ a⁢ 5⁤ Pin Rocker Switch Wiring System

When it comes to troubleshooting ‍and maintaining a 5 pin rocker switch wiring system, here are some ⁤pro tips to keep in​ mind:

  • Inspect your connections: ⁤Periodically check the connections of your⁤ rocker ‌switch to ensure they⁤ are secure and free from any⁣ dirt or corrosion. Loose⁣ or dirty connections can cause intermittent functionality ‍or even complete ‍failure.
  • Test⁤ the switch with a multimeter: If you‍ notice your⁤ rocker switch is not working properly,⁤ use a multimeter​ to measure ⁤voltage across the terminals. This will help you identify if the issue‍ lies ‍with the switch⁢ itself ‍or with the ‍wiring.
  • Check ⁣for proper grounding: Poor grounding can lead to various issues, such as flickering lights or malfunctioning accessories. ‍Take a close look‌ at‍ the grounding wire and ensure it is securely connected⁢ to a clean and metal surface.
  • Inspect the fuse: In case of ⁤a sudden⁢ loss of power, check the fuse associated with the ‍rocker switch. ⁤A blown fuse can often be the ​culprit behind​ a malfunctioning switch.

By ‍following these simple⁢ pro tips, you can troubleshoot and maintain your 5 pin ⁢rocker switch wiring system with ease.‍ Remember,‍ attention to detail and regular inspections are key to ensuring a reliable and efficient electrical setup.
